基于WebAssembly的移动网站高性能计算应用案例

首页 / 新闻资讯 / 基于WebAssembly的移动网站高性

基于WebAssembly的移动网站高性能计算应用案例

📅 2026-05-02 🔖 网站建设专家,手机网站开发制作,wap网站制作开发,企业网站建设,移动网站制作

近年来,移动端用户对网页交互体验的要求越来越高,从简单的信息浏览转向了需要复杂计算的场景,比如在线3D产品展示、实时图像处理或AR试妆。然而,传统的JavaScript在移动浏览器中执行密集计算时,往往会出现页面卡顿、耗电过快的问题,这正是许多企业网站建设时遇到的性能瓶颈。

为什么移动端“算不动”?

核心原因在于JavaScript是解释型语言,其单线程模型天生不适合CPU密集型任务。当我们在手机网站上执行一个复杂的算法,比如实时滤镜渲染,JS会阻塞DOM渲染,导致用户滑动页面时出现明显掉帧。更关键的是,移动设备的CPU性能远逊于桌面端,这让传统方案的短板暴露无遗。作为专业的网站建设专家,我们深知这种体验对于转化率的打击是致命的。

WebAssembly:让浏览器“跑”起原生代码

WebAssembly(Wasm)的出现改变了游戏规则。它是一种低级的二进制指令格式,可以被浏览器直接解析,运行速度接近原生。通过将C/C++/Rust编写的代码编译成.wasm模块,再加载到移动网页中,我们可以把复杂的计算任务从JS线程中剥离出来。例如,在手机网站开发制作中集成一个基于Wasm的CAD模型查看器,其渲染帧率可以从15fps提升到60fps,内存占用反而降低40%。

  • 性能飞跃:Wasm的启动和解析速度比JS快5-10倍
  • 跨平台兼容:所有主流移动浏览器均已支持Wasm v1.0
  • 安全沙箱:Wasm运行在独立沙箱中,不牺牲移动端的安全性

实战对比:JS vs Wasm,差距在哪里?

以我们服务过的一个wap网站制作开发项目为例,客户需要一个在线PDF文档解析与渲染功能。如果完全使用企业网站建设常见的纯JS方案,解析一个50页的PDF需要耗时约6秒,且页面会完全冻结。而引入基于Wasm的PDF.js版本后,解析时间缩短至1.2秒,用户可以在后台继续操作页面。这种对比在移动网站制作场景下尤为明显,因为用户对加载延迟的容忍度极低——超过3秒的卡顿就会导致53%的用户流失。

  1. 图像处理:Wasm方案处理一张4K图片的锐化滤镜仅需200ms,JS方案需要1.8s
  2. 物理引擎:在移动端运行3D碰撞检测,Wasm帧率稳定在55fps,JS在20fps以下
  3. 加密解密:Wasm执行RSA-2048解密的速度是JS的12倍

给建站团队的建议

如果你正在规划一个对计算性能有高要求的移动网站,建议优先评估核心计算模块能否用Rust或C++重写。不必全盘替换JS,而是采用“JS负责UI交互,Wasm负责计算”的混合架构。对于网站建设专家而言,掌握Wasm的调试工具(如Chrome DevTools中的Wasm调试面板)和优化技巧(如流式编译、多线程共享内存)将成为下一阶段的核心竞争力。从实际项目经验来看,投入1-2天进行Wasm适配,就能换取用户端2-3倍的操作流畅度提升,这笔投资非常值得。

相关推荐

📄

网站建设专家解析:如何利用结构化数据提升搜索展现

2026-05-01

📄

手机网站制作与PC网站建设的技术差异分析

2026-05-03

📄

如何评估网站建设公司的技术实力与服务交付能力

2026-05-06

📄

企业网站建设中的网站网站HTTPS证书自动续期配置

2026-04-24

📄

网站建设专家解析容器化技术在网站部署中的价值

2026-04-24

📄

移动网站制作中SVG图形在图标与动画中的优势

2026-04-24